Atlanta, GA

Fulton County

Few Restrictions

Atlanta encourages high-albedo roofs through the Sustainable Building Ordinance and ATL2050 heat-island goals, but does not require cool roofs on private homes; LEED projects must meet SRI thresholds.

Atlanta FAQ

Do I need a cool roof for a reroof permit?

No. Residential reroofs follow the Georgia state energy code. Cool-roof materials are optional but may qualify for utility rebates and reduce attic temperatures noticeably.

Is white the only cool color?

No. Many tile and shingle products meet SRI thresholds in lighter grays and tans. Look for Cool Roof Rating Council labels when shopping reflective materials.
